Roof Geometry & Structural Review
We map rafters, roof planes, vents, and setbacks, evaluating snow loads and wind exposure. When needed, an engineer reviews structure and local code requirements. The final layout optimizes string lengths, wire runs, and maintenance access without compromising safety or roof longevity.

Shading Analysis & Yield Modeling
Using advanced solar irradiance data and horizon profiles, we quantify seasonal shading from trees, chimneys, and nearby buildings. The model informs panel positioning, optimizer use, and inverter selection, improving daytime performance while accurately forecasting annual production and bill savings.

High‑Efficiency Panels Built for Canada
Our panels feature strong snow‑load ratings, anti‑reflective glass, durable frames, and excellent low‑light response. They are tested for hail resistance and backed by performance warranties, ensuring consistent output during winter months and long productive lifespans under harsh conditions.
Inverters and Power Optimizers
We match string inverters or microinverters to your roof geometry and shading profile. Rapid shutdown, arc‑fault detection, and module‑level monitoring enhance safety and diagnostics, while thoughtful placement reduces noise, improves serviceability, and maintains system uptime through seasonal changes.
Racking, Flashing, and Weatherproofing
Snow guards, sealed penetrations, and corrosion‑resistant hardware protect your roof. We select racking that meets local load requirements and integrates cleanly with shingles or metal. Attention to sealing and drainage safeguards waterproofing and minimizes future maintenance concerns.

Bill Reduction Modeling
Our analysis uses your hourly usage, rate plan, and solar yield to calculate expected monthly bills after installation. We quantify shoulder seasons, winter effects, and summer peaks, then present side‑by‑side comparisons to validate realistic, conservative savings estimates.
Net Metering & Credit Strategy
We align system size with local net‑metering rules, time‑of‑use rates, and carryover policies, ensuring credits are used efficiently. You’ll see how seasonal balances resolve and how slight sizing adjustments can optimize savings without overbuilding capacity.
Long‑Term Performance & Degradation
We model panel degradation, inverter replacement cycles, and maintenance costs over twenty‑five years. The projection includes inflation assumptions and potential utility rate escalations, providing a thorough, transparent view of payback and internal rate of return under realistic conditions.

Backup & Resilience
Enhance reliability with battery storage and critical loads panels that keep essentials running during outages, designed to work seamlessly with your solar system and local electrical standards.
- Battery Storage Options We size batteries for outage duration, critical circuits, and seasonal solar availability. Chemistry, warranty, and scalability are considered alongside rate structures, ensuring resilient performance and long‑term value under Canadian weather conditions and utility policies.
- Critical Loads Panel Design We identify and rewire essential circuits like refrigeration, internet, lighting, medical devices, and heating controls. The dedicated panel ensures predictable backup behavior, maximizing limited energy during outages while maintaining code compliance and safety.
- Generator Compatibility If you already have or plan a generator, we design safe transfer switching and harmonized settings with storage and solar. Proper coordination prevents backfeeding risks and maintains smooth transitions when power returns or conditions change.
